A Rosetown doctor has been fined and had their licence temporarily suspended after a disciplinary process was begun by the College of Physicians and Surgeons of Saskatchewan. 

Dr. Ashwani Narang was charged with ‘unprofessional conduct’ for accessing personal health records for a number of individuals of whom he did not have a ‘physician-patient’ relationship. 

Through the discipline process Dr. Narang admitted to the wrong doing. As a result, his licence has been suspended for three months and he has been fined in the amount of $23,597.96 

The suspension was handed down at the end of September.
